FBC Delair family, we are so grateful that you’re choosing to be a part of these 21 days of prayer and fasting. This isn’t about religious duty or trying to prove something to God; this is about drawing nearer to Him with sincere hearts and making room for His presence to move in us.

 Fasting has a way of quieting the noise in our lives so that we can hear God more clearly. It strengthens our spiritual hunger, sharpens our discernment, and positions our hearts for Christly renewal. When we fast, we’re not trying to impress God (or anyone else), we’re simply saying, “LORD, You matter more than anything else.”

What kinds of fasts can I do?

Here are a few Biblical and practical options:

1. Full Fast

·    Water only (use wisdom and consult a doctor, if needed)

2. Daniel Fast

·    Fruits, vegetables, whole grains, water (based on Daniel chapters 1 & 10)

3. Partial Fast

·    Skipping one or two meals per day

·    Fasting from certain foods (sweets, caffeine, bread, etc.)

4.  Non-Food Fast

·    Social media, TV, streaming, gaming, etc.

·    Great for those who can’t fast from food due to medical conditions.
